Patient Safety Specialist jobs in Newark, NJ

Patient Safety Specialist assists in the development and implementation of patient safety programs. Gathers data detailing patient-related errors and conducts analysis for management detailing the cause of the error. Being a Patient Safety Specialist recommends changes, policies, or programs that could prevent future errors. Gives presentations and training programs meant to increase awareness of patient safety initiatives. Additionally, Patient Safety Specialist tests patient-safety knowledge of employees and recommends changes to training programs.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Patient Safety Specialist cont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. Work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. To be a Patient Safety Specialist typically requires 4 to 7 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    Responsibilities

    The Patient Safety Attendant is responsible for providing continuous observation of assigned patients,virtually and in-person as needed.

    This includes verbally redirecting patient form engaging in any at-risk behaviors and notifying nursing staff when patients need assistance.

    1. Maintains visual observation at all times. Verbally redirects patients over audio and / or visual devices that are in the patient rooms.

    2. Makes rounds to patient rooms that are set up with virtual observation.

    3. Completes observation records and reports as required.

    4. Reports any unusual behavior to the nurse i.e. confusion or disorientation.

    5. Identifies the needs of the patient population served and modifies and delivers care that is specific to those needs.

    Qualifications

    Education,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Required :

    1. High School diploma, general equivalency diploma (GED), and / or GED equivalent programs.

    2. American Heart Association BLS certificate (required within 60 days of hire).

    2. Capable of continuous monitoring of patients and always remaining alert while on duty.

    3. Ability to stay mobile according to the patient's movements including the ability to sit or stand for extended periods of time.

    4. Ability to communicate effectively with patients using audio / visual devices.

    5. Must be able to work in situations with isolation precautions.

    Preferred :

    1. Prior experience working in a hospital setting.

    2. Prior experience in a direct patient care role.

Newark (/ˈnjuːərk/,[24] locally /njʊərk/)[25] is the most populous city in the U.S. state of New Jersey and the seat of Essex County.[26] As one of the nation's major air, shipping, and rail hubs, the city had a population of 285,154 in 2017, making it the nation's 70th-most populous municipality, after being ranked 63rd in the nation in 2000. Settled in 1666 by Puritans from New Haven Colony, Newark is one of the oldest cities in the United States.
